
Schema markup auto-generation on website, funnel & webinar publish
Overview
EveryCatch now includes a new setting, Auto-generate schema, that automatically creates schema markup for any page you publish that does not already have it.
Previously, you had to add schema manually, one page at a time, in the editor. If you did not add it before publishing, the page went live with no structured data, which limited your visibility in search engines and AI answer experiences (AEO/GEO).
With this update, when the setting is on and you publish a page that has no schema:
- AI generates schema markup for that page automatically in the background
- Publishing is never delayed, because schema generation runs in parallel and does not hold up the page going live
- Existing schema is preserved and never overwritten
- It runs on all page-specific publish paths: Builder Publish, save-triggered publish, and version-history publish
- Available for Websites, Funnels, and Webinars
You will find this under Settings, in the new SEO & AEO section.
- Auto-generate schema – "Automatically add schema markup to pages that don't have it when published."
Why this matters
Schema markup powers rich results in Google and helps AI answer engines understand and cite your pages. Many users either forget or do not have time to add it. Auto-generation keeps structured data in place on every published page with zero extra work from you, so your SEO/AEO/GEO presence is protected by default.
Impact on existing users
- No data loss. Existing schema is preserved and never overwritten.
- Assets created before this release: the setting defaults to OFF, so nothing changes unless you turn it on.
- Assets created on or after this release: the setting defaults to ON, so new pages that you publish without schema get it automatically.
- You have full control. You can toggle it per Website, Funnel, or Webinar, then click Save.
Action required
You do not need to change anything for existing assets. They keep their current behavior with Auto-generate schema set to OFF. If you prefer that new assets do not auto-generate schema, switch the toggle off under Settings → SEO & AEO and click Save.
